5.0 out of 5 stars Definitive 20th-Century Trumpet, July 6, 2009
Ole Edvard Antonsen has become a major force in contemporary trumpet playing, but this recording is essential to understanding his playing and his career. The story goes that Antonsen spent himself deeply into debt to make this recording and funds to complete the project were supplied by a Norwegian government grant. Antonsen's determination to produce a breakthrough recording of the highest quality brought a tremendous success and launched his brilliant career.

The program varies only narrowly, but all the pieces are excellent. From the accessible and lyric "Intrada" of Honnegger and the "Four Variations on a Theme of Scarlatti" by Marcel Bitsch, to more edgy pieces by Sutermeister and Francaix, to sprawling unaccompanied pieces like Hvoslef's "Tromba Solo" (11 minutes without a rest!) and Friedman's "Solus," Antonsen's technique and musicality never even hint at a weakness. His tone is brilliant and resonant in every register, and his speed and virtuosity are uncanny.

This is recording is a rarity, and has already been in and out of print a few times, so I'm glad to see it available in .mp3. If you're a fan of Antonsen, a serious contemporary music listener, or an aspiring trumpeter, I strongly recommend this recording. It occupies a critical place in a wide and varied field, and will be a treasured item in your collection.
